Supplementary Figure 1: Ci-VSD R217E structure details at 2.5-Å resolution.

From: Structural mechanism of voltage-dependent gating in an isolated voltage-sensing domain

Supplementary Figure 1

(a) The Ci-VSD-R217E+33F12_4 crystal belongs to space group P6522 and contains 12 complexes (6 homodimers) in the unit cell. The dimer is formed with a crystallographically related symmetry partner on a screw axis. (b) 2Fo-Fc electron density maps (σ=1.0) of Ci-VSD-R217E complex. The S4 segment is colored in red. (c) Close-up view of R217E structure. The side chains are well resolved at 2.5 Å resolution throughout Ci-VSD including the gating arginine residues (magenta) R223, R226, R229 and R232. (d) Three LDAO detergent molecules and one succinic acid molecule were resolved around S3-S4 loop region of R217E structure (yellow sticks).
